It’s Not Just About a Number


While credit scores are one part of the puzzle, lenders look at the full picture—what we call your credit health. That includes how long you’ve had credit, how responsibly you’ve used it, your current debts, and even your history of on-time payments.

Good credit isn’t about being perfect—it’s about showing consistency and a responsible approach to managing your financial commitments. And yes, we’ve helped buyers with a wide range of credit backgrounds successfully purchase homes across the Triad.


Signs You May Be Closer Than You Think:

  • You make your payments on time, even if it’s just the minimum
  • You’ve started reducing credit card balances
  • You avoid opening new accounts you don’t need
  • You’re actively budgeting or reviewing your credit report


If that sounds like you, you’re already taking steps in the right direction.
